摘要: "57 三数之和" 给出一个有n个整数的数组S,在S中找到三个整数a, b, c,找到所有使得a + b + c = 0的三元组。 注意事项 在三元组(a, b, c),要求a 结果不能包含重复的三元组。 样例 如S = { 1 0 1 2 1 4}, 你需要返回的三元组集合的是: ( 1, 0, 阅读全文
posted @ 2017-06-28 17:38 LiBaoquan 阅读(1398) 评论(0) 推荐(0) 编辑
摘要: "55 比较字符串" 比较两个字符串A和B,确定A中是否包含B中所有的字符。字符串A和B中的字符都是 大写字母 注意事项 在 A 中出现的 B 字符串里的字符不需要连续或者有序。 样例 给出 A = "ABCD" B = "ACD",返回 true 给出 A = "ABCD" B = "AABC", 阅读全文
posted @ 2017-06-28 12:32 LiBaoquan 阅读(435) 评论(0) 推荐(0) 编辑
摘要: "52 下一个排列" 给定一个整数数组来表示排列,找出其之后的一个排列。 注意事项 排列中可能包含重复的整数 样例 给出排列[1,3,2,3],其下一个排列是[1,3,3,2] 给出排列[4,3,2,1],其下一个排列是[1,2,3,4] 标签 排列 LintCode 版权所有 思路 从后往前找,找 阅读全文
posted @ 2017-06-28 11:20 LiBaoquan 阅读(1174) 评论(0) 推荐(0) 编辑